But what is Gratitude

Colloquially, gratitude is an expression of thanks and appreciation. However, gratitude has its
origins as a distinct emotion. Typically, the feeling lasts for only a few seconds, as a recognition of the
intentional, beneficial actions of others. (Amit Amin)
